About The Position

The Project Controls II is a key member of one or more Project Teams and plays a critical role in ensuring financial accuracy, contractual compliance, and adherence to union agreements across assigned projects. This position supports field and management teams by enforcing cost controls, maintaining compliance with collective bargaining agreements (CBAs), customer contracts, and company policies, and ensuring the integrity of project financial reporting. The Project Controls II regularly interfaces with Project Managers, field leadership, union labor representatives, customers, vendors, and internal departments to support compliant project execution in a highly regulated construction environment.

Responsibilities

  • Under direct supervision, support the Project Team by collecting, reviewing, and validating financial data related to project cost measurement, customer billings, accounts payable, payroll entries, and fleet and equipment utilization.
  • Assist in maintaining accurate and timely project financial records in accordance with company policies and project requirements.
  • Support the preparation and review of customer billings to ensure accuracy, completeness, and compliance with contract terms.
  • Assist in researching and resolving accounts payable and transaction discrepancies, partnering with Project Management, Accounting, and vendors as needed.
  • Monitor project activity for compliance with customer contracts, internal company policies, procedures, and administrative guidelines.
  • Support tracking and reporting of project costs, commitments, and variances under guidance of senior project controls or finance personnel.
  • Assist with documentation and recordkeeping to support audits, internal reviews, and client requirements.
  • Collaborate with project and operations teams to support effective financial controls and transparency.
